Abstract

P=?NPP \overset{\text{?}}{=} NP or P vs NPP\ vs\ NP is the core problem in computational complexity theory. In this paper, we proposed a definition of linear correlation of derived matrix and system, and discussed the linear correlation of PP and NPNP. We draw a conclusion that PP is linearly dependent and there exists NPNP which is is linearly independent and take a 3SAT instance which belongs to NPNP as the example , that is, PNPP \neq NP.
